bunch a group of things of the same kind that are attached to each other.
every each member or part of a group.
flicker1 to burn or shine in an unsteady way.
flock a group of animals or birds of one kind that stay or are kept together.
incredible difficult or impossible to believe.
match2 a person or thing that is very like another.
pant to breathe in quick, short breaths; gasp.
peak the highest part of a mountain, or the highest part of anything.
plot1 the story line or order of events in a book, play, or movie.
shut to close by moving something that covers an opening.
split a division between two or more people.
stir to mix liquids together or move a liquid in a circle using your hand or an object.
tall of more than average height.
wagon a small, open cart with four wheels and a handle, used as a child's toy.
weight the quality that makes something heavy.
